The prevalent S&P 500 index encompasses a diverse range of companies across various sectors. For investors seeking targeted exposure to specific industries, sector ETFs offer a convenient solution. Explore the successive factors when identifying sector ETFs within the S&P 500 framework:
- Portfolio Goals: Define your aspirations for each sector allocation.
- Operating Costs: Compare the ongoing costs associated with different ETFs.
- Deviation: Assess how closely an ETF follows its underlying benchmark index.
Moreover, perform thorough research on individual companies within each sector ETF to guarantee alignment with your investment philosophy. By diligently evaluating these factors, investors can effectively course through the world of sector ETFs within the S&P 500.

The S&P 500 index, a bellwether of the U.S. equities market, is segmented into distinct sectors, each highlighting a particular industry group. This categorization provides investors with targeted exposure to specific areas of the economy, allowing for allocation of portfolios based on market outlook. Sector ETFs, which track the performance of these S&P 500 sectors, have emerged as a attractive investment tool, offering both {liquidity{and accessibility to investors seeking to participate in the growth potential of individual industry segments.
- Moreover, sector ETFs offer several advantages over traditional stock picking.
- They deliver instant exposure across a basket of stocks within a particular sector, reducing the risk associated with investing in individual companies.
- Moreover, sector ETFs are typically expense-efficient, making them an accessible option for both institutional investors.
By carefully analyzing the performance and outlook of different S&P 500 sectors, investors can construct portfolios that align with their investment objectives.
